0
votes
0answers
10 views

Passing Variables to web worker

I need to make a web worker, The worker will calculate car rental cost by km's that will be drawn from google maps api, i have the next script: function calcRoute() { var start = ...
0
votes
1answer
41 views

IE 11 crashes when using web worker with large data in MVC 4

I have an application that is crashing in Internet Explorer 11 when i navigate from 1 page to another. I have 2 pages, A viewer page and a listing page. the viewer page has a web worker which starts ...
0
votes
1answer
52 views

Can/should HTML5 Web Workers use CORS for cross-origin?

I ran into an interesting problem while creating a hosted API that relies on web workers. I was hoping to get a little community feedback on it. My server is set up with the appropriate CORS headers ...
1
vote
0answers
26 views

console.log is not pretty printing an object in web worker, instead it just shows [object Object]

I am passing an object to a web worker, and priot to passing it console.log pretty prints it with clickable properties. Now, inside web worker when I do a console.log I just get an [object Object] ...
0
votes
0answers
28 views

Server Sent Events in Firefox Shared Web Workers

I am attempting to use an EventSource (Server Sent Events) within a Shared Web Worker in Firefox. When I attempt to try and use the EventSource constructor in the message event in the Shared Worker, ...
0
votes
1answer
37 views

Web Workers and JSON

I am sure there is something that I am missing from this code, I just can not figure out what it is. Here is the main page: <script> function wwCallback(e) { ...
0
votes
1answer
17 views

Is importScripts() only for webworkers?

Can it be used as a means of including code from external .js files outside of the context of webworkers?
1
vote
1answer
48 views

HTML5 Web Worker does not respond to message

Consider the following code: worker.js onmessage = function(evt){ postMessage({data:"foo",id:evt.data.id}); }; master.js (embedded in some HTML) function startWorker(count){ var running = ...
0
votes
0answers
23 views

HTML5 Webworker Startup Synchronization Guarantees

I have a bit of javascript I want to run in a webworker, and I am having a hard time understanding the correct approach to getting them to work in lock-step. I invoke the WebWorker from the main ...
0
votes
1answer
55 views

What is best practice to pass binary data between WebWorker and main thread?

To my knowledge you can only pass a string or a object which can be seralize as JSON. Then what is the best way to pass some image files between workers and main page if I am using WebWorker to ...
3
votes
1answer
75 views

JavaScript Grid that create markup in HTML5 Web Worker

I am working on Business intelligence based web dashboard, i have tried several Third party JavaScript grids namely JQGrid, ng-grid. Problem is that when Grid try to Render with big data Object it ...
3
votes
1answer
111 views

Are web workers green or red?

We can create a new instance of a web worker as such: var worker = new Worker('task.js'); Are each web worker backed by its own native thread, or is there a pool of native threads allocated per ...
0
votes
0answers
75 views

Scale Kinetic.js image using web worker

Is there any way to scale extra large Kinetic.js images using Web Worker? The main problem i stuck about is how do i pass that image to worker (in bitmap array form i think) and then get it back ...
0
votes
1answer
37 views

Is it possible to read local variables of parent stackframes?

Scenario: I am working on Javascript code that allows running arbitrary user-supplied code in a web worker environment, similar to this approach. Let's call the two parties host (launches the worker) ...
3
votes
0answers
111 views

Web worker file is cached and never re-loaded in IE 11

I am running a simple HTML5 app that works in Chrome and Firefox. It uses a web worker, as in: var worker = new Worker("the/worker/URL/Code.js"); I have experimented for over an hour in IE, and I ...
0
votes
1answer
160 views

Web worker out of memory in HTML5 canvas processing

In Main thread : I get the source image array by getImageData method. It is a uint8ClampedArray to record my image data. Here is my code in web worker : (this code will give me a high resolution ...
0
votes
1answer
148 views

Using Web-Workers in stand alone V8 Javascript Engine

I tried to adopt the shell.cc sample from the V8 distribution package for my own purposes. I want to spawn a web-worker to execute a long-running script, and execute: var myWorker = new ...
1
vote
1answer
117 views

How do i create dynamic div element using WEB WORKER in Javascript?

I have a project where I need to create a thousands of DIV elements when I first load the index, I tried WEB Workers so that my loading time can be saved a bit. I am not able to create an Dynamic Div ...
5
votes
0answers
172 views

Web worker won't start in IE unless the cache is cleared

I'm having a really weird bug in my HTML5 script. I wrote a sharepoint app completely in OData which uses a few HTML 5 webworker to do the number crunching in the background. This works perfect on all ...
0
votes
1answer
25 views

How to limit a number of web workers

I use web workers to calculate a bit of information in my application. And I don't want to kill the application with an increasing number of web workers so I need to limit creating new workers ...
0
votes
2answers
42 views

HTML5 Call to global function from Worker

I have a global function in Utils.js called "sendAndWaitCommand". When I'm try to call this function form the Worker (name 'uploadToDevice.js'), the Worker crashes. Worker Initialization var ...
2
votes
1answer
58 views

Running JS in a killable 'thread'; detecting and canceling long-running processes

Summary: How can I execute a JavaScript function, but then "execute" (kill) it if it does not finish with a timeframe (e.g. 2 seconds)? Details I'm writing a web application for interactively ...
0
votes
1answer
98 views

prototype not working within web worker

Simply speaking I am trying to prototype a function within a web worker and chromium is throwing this error: Uncaught TypeError: Object #<DedicatedWorkerContext> has no method 'compute' I ...
0
votes
1answer
30 views

Parsing XML to indexedDB without 'slowing the browser'

Let me start of with outlining the situation. A Standalone HTML5 app indexedDB should get populated with data from a series of XML files (the parsing is nontrivial). The functionality powered by this ...
3
votes
0answers
63 views

Is there a way of sharing a google.maps.Map instance using web workers?

Since workers do not have access to window or DOM elements, is it possible to have multiple web workers doing stuff on the same google maps instance? The use case: a real-time map visualisation where ...
1
vote
2answers
90 views

Web worker: NotFoundError when I try to read a file created in the main thread

In Chrome 32, I've got an JS app where I write raw images from a canvas to a file and I want to close the file and open it for processing in a worker. I pass the file name to the worker and I can see ...
0
votes
1answer
55 views

creating a progression bar while a webpage is loading using web worker

cause i have high res images... and a lot of background images n graphics.. thats why i want to the webpage to load all contains ,then display when its all loaded.. but at the same time when contains ...
-2
votes
1answer
800 views

Upload chunked file using XHR and web workers

Hi everyone and happy new year :) I want to upload a file using XHR and web workers, sending chunks of the file and merging at the end. The problem is that the end file is empty, I think that the ...
5
votes
0answers
358 views

EXC_BAD_ACCESS (SIGSEGV) in WebCore::UserGestureIndicator::processingUserGesture

I have an iOS application built using a UIWebView and HTML5 websockets. The app experiences seemingly random crashes. It has occurred while a user is interacting with it and during longevity tests ...
0
votes
0answers
34 views

worker postmessage is not firing after some time

Iam making a Worker Thread start , in this thread I make an Ajax call to get data and on worker receive message i bind data to grid. NOTE ; I have 10 grids and whenever I change context(grid changes) ...
5
votes
3answers
130 views

Is it fundamentally wrong to write a CPU intensive client side HTML5 application? [closed]

It is possible and sensible to plan on writing a client side HTML5 Application that will be doing some CPU intensive calculations? (Image processing) I know that it's usually has been the standard to ...
0
votes
1answer
34 views

Javascript - stub/substitute of object

In GWT framework there is a class JsoSplittable, which contains following code ($wnd is reference to global window object): return $wnd.JSON && $wnd.JSON.stringify && ...
0
votes
1answer
61 views

ImportScripts : NetworkError

Im doing an importScripts in my Worker file ( JS file ) and it throws an error "Network Error" , im not sure why my script loading is being failed , the same url I use in IE browser the files is ...
3
votes
2answers
784 views

Cross Domain Web Worker?

I have https://domain1.com (domain1) and https://domain2.com (domain2). Domain2 serves a page containing javascript with a header "Access-Control-Allow-Origin: *" Domain1 runs some javascript code ...
1
vote
1answer
109 views

How to I refer to the `postMessage()` function from my XHR callbacks?

The file uploads work perfectly, I can't get the progess and load events to callback I have the following in a JavaScript file as my WebWorker code: UploadFileWorker.js function uploadFile(url, m) ...
2
votes
1answer
270 views

What happens to a Web Worker if I close the page that created this Web Worker?

Let's say I have a page called Main.html that creates a web worker. If I close the Main page by changing window.location, would the web worker be terminated or would the web worker be still running? ...
0
votes
0answers
149 views

Any benefits of using async html5 APIs with web workers in case we don't expect any callback at all

I have a specific script which Tries to read find some artifacts (binary and text) in local html5 filesystem. If that attempt fails, requesting those artifacts via http Stores all artifacts fetched ...
0
votes
3answers
116 views

Image compression inside HTML5 Web Worker

I have a web application which create a big image (30Mo) as a bufferArray inside a web worker. I would like to return this image to the main thread. Return the bufferArray via the postMessage method ...
0
votes
1answer
549 views

Web worker debugging in firefox

This might seem like a very silly question, but how can i get the UI for the worker thread, containing the javascript like in chrome, you get a URL for the worker thread when debugging, for firefox ? ...
1
vote
3answers
282 views

Why aren't Web Workers used more?

Web Workers are a technology that I brush up against from time to time, whether as the subject of blog post, or a mention in a presentation. During a more recent presentation I attended, the speaker ...
0
votes
0answers
40 views

Message channel in shared worker in chrome is not working

Does message channel work in shared worker in chrome.I implemented successfully message channel in webworker by passing channel ends to seperate worker.When i am doing same thing in shared worker ...
0
votes
1answer
162 views

SQLite in Javascript: Too much data in memory

I have an HTML5 application that incorporates a few SQLite APIs to create an application that can: Read a sqlite database on a clients computer (based on user input) and load the contents to memory. ...
1
vote
2answers
294 views

multiple webRTC connections

Can we technically open multiple webRTC connections from a browser to a server? Or each instance of a browser can make only one single webRTC connections to a specific server? I am thinking to use ...
1
vote
0answers
124 views

cannot upload files and vars with xhr2 and web workers

I try to create code to upload files using XHR2 and web workers. I thought I should use web workers , so if a file is big, web page will not freeze. This is not working for two reasons, I never used ...
1
vote
2answers
256 views

javascript:worker synchronization

I am working on HTML5 web worker and I made a function that spawn few workers and return the result, but problem is that it returns the value before the worker updates the result. So I want to delay ...
1
vote
0answers
92 views

ImageData loses it's interface when using WebWorker

I'm trying to use a web worker for processing some ImageData but I am running into problems when trying to put back the image data. First I send some ImageData to my worker: worker.postMessage({ ...
1
vote
1answer
548 views

JavaScript performance when handling large arrays

I'm currently writing an image editing program in JavaScript. I've chosen JS because I wanted to learn more about it. The average image I'm handling is about 3000 x 4000 pixels big. When converted ...
1
vote
2answers
395 views

HTML5/JS - Start several webworkers

I'm currently writing on a program, where I have to deal with huge arrays. I can however split those arrays. My plan now is, to process the arrays in different web workers. I have however never worked ...
1
vote
0answers
103 views

Why doesn't the standard allow usage of importScripts() outside of a web worker?

What's the technical/security/... reason for not providing the importScripts() in the main thread as well? I know it's easy to implement in alternative ways (adding script tags, XHR+eval), that's ...
9
votes
5answers
2k views

Is there a way to create out of DOM elements in Web Worker?

Context: I have a web application that processes and shows huge log files. They're usually only about 100k lines long, but it can be up to 4 million lines or more. To be able to scroll through that ...